Kristen Wiig wasn’t the only Saturday Night Live alum to return to the show last night.

Fellow former cast member Jason Sudeikis made a surprise cameo to reprise his portrayal of Mitt Romney, as SNL spoofed Saturday’s meeting between the former Massachusetts governor and President-elect Donald Trump.

After a very prolonged hand shake, Romney, who had been an uncompromising critic of candidate Trump, breaks the silence.

“This isn’t going to work, is it?” he asks.

“I don’t think so,” responds Alec Baldwin, in his first post-election skit as Trump. Romney then leaves.

The sketch as a whole mocked Trump’s ability to cope with the seriousness of the presidency and to follow through on some of his more lofty campaign pledges.

Once again, the sketch apparently hit a nerve with the Republican president-elect, who expressed his displeasure in a tweet Sunday morning.
